Protecting yourself from bullets is a little complicated.

First, you have to purchase the carrier (It holds the 'body armour') then you have to purchase the inserts. (That's the stuff that really stops bullets)

Needless to say, not every insert will stop the same type of bullet. Yeap, there are protection levels.

Second, fabric (Yes, the most popular 'bullet-proof' material, kelvar, is a fabric) won't stop knives. A knife will cut through kelvar, just like ... butter.

So, ... You have to purchase an anti-stab vest, if you're seeking protection from knives.

Third, most folks aren't going to need a vest.

Why?

You are going to move to a different neighborhood, a different state, or a different country 'If' you and your family are facing a threat that requires you to wear body armour, you are going to move!!!

With that said, some folks are going to want to purchase some vests for tough times. You'll need two, one for concealment and one overt.

The concealable one, is probably going to be a kelvar vest that's designed to defeat 9mm rounds, Level II. These vest are worn when you and your partner are out and about doing needed shopping around town. You know, ... grocery shopping because you're trying to preserve your long-term food storage.

The overt vest is going to be something ... tactical. Think these United States' military ...
